motorcycle
Plural: motorcycles
Noun
- a motor vehicle with two wheels and a strong frame
- An open-seated motor vehicle with handlebars instead of a steering wheel, and having two (or sometimes three) wheels.
Verb
- ride a motorcycle
- To ride a motorcycle.
Origin / Etymology
From motor + cycle, from the Motorcyclette produced in 1897 by the French Werner Frères et Cie.
